ABSTRACT:
Separate memory management units are described for use with a central processing unit to separately control expanding stack and data memory portions within a single logical memory segment. The stack and data portions are prevented from expanding into each other by a break register which contains an address between the two memory portions and is updated as the stack and data memory portions expand and contract. The stack memory management unit only is enabled when a portion of the memory is addressed on one side of the break value while the data memory management unit only is utilized when the address is on the other side of the break value.
